Polyphenylene Sulfide Market Overview

Polyphenylene Sulfide market size is forecast to reach US$3.1 billion by 2027 after growing at a CAGR of 10.2% during 2022-2027. Polyphenylene sulfide comes in the form of a semi-crystalline organic polymer that’s made from p-substituted benzene and sulfur rings. Polyphenylene Sulfide (PPS) is also a high-performance engineering plastic with excellent mechanical properties like stiffness, creep resistance, and strength, and has the ability to maintain dimensional stability in harsh environments. Polyphenylene sulfide is produced in the form of a synthetic fibre that has a low viscosity which makes it flexible to be molded into desired forms, is environment friendly as it is recyclable, and has flame retarding properties for electrical and high-temperature applications. The demand for polyphenylene sulfide is growing since it is used to manufacture different electrical and electronic components such as plugs, switches, relay components, and electrical insulation. Polyphenylene sulfide is also widely applied in the automotive industry as well for fuel system parts, induction systems, coolant systems, and lighting components. The polyphenylene sulfide market is majorly driven by such industries and increasing industrialization in emerging countries of Asia-Pacific is driving the polyphenylene sulfide market.

Polyphenylene Sulfide Market Segment Analysis – By Grade

The glass-reinforced grades segment held the largest share of 42% in the polyphenylene sulfide market in 2021. Glass-reinforced graded polyphenylene sulfide (PPS) appears to be semi-crystalline and is a much-preferred engineering thermoplastic, as it offers great resistance to chemicals, and others, compared to any other plastics, as well as possesses great dimensional stability and strength. It is identified that no known solvents can affect or have an impact on this polyphenylene sulfide grade under the degree of 392 Fahrenheit, as well as it is inert to steam, strong bases, fuels, and acids. Glass-reinforced graded polyphenylene sulfide is an ideal material for precise tolerance machined components as it has very minimal water absorption, is stress-relieving manufactured, and has a very low coefficient of linear thermal expansion. Glass-reinforced graded polyphenylene sulfide is additionally considered to be a great option for structural applications, in corrosive environments, and as a lower temperature replacement for polyether ether ketone (PEEK). The 40% glass-reinforced grade of quadrant polyphenylene sulfide is the most recognized and consumed grade of Polyphenylene sulfide. It is compression molded so that it offers better dimensional stability and thermal performance than other grades. Polyphenylene Sulfide Market Segment Analysis – By Type

The linear polyphenylene sulfide segment held the largest share of 46% in the polyphenylene sulfide market in 2021. Linear polyphenylene sulfide is widely used mainly for its commercial ease of processing. The molecular weight of linear polyphenylene sulfide is almost double in comparison to regular polyphenylene sulfide. Linear polyphenylene sulfide has increased molecular chain length, due to which it offers higher tenacity, better impact strength, and greater elongation, which makes it tougher and allows it to be applied in a wide range of processes from thin section injection molding to blow molding. Linear polyphenylene sulfide also has low ionic impurities, which makes it useful to be applied to fuel cell parts as well as in fields, where heavy and durable electrical properties are required. Due to the above properties, linear polyphenylene sulfide can be extruded, blow-molded, or compression molded into blocks, rods, and other shapes that are generally used for prototyping. Unfilled linear polyphenylene sulfide is additionally utilized in melt-spun and melt-blown to produce fibers and fabrics, which will be used for the filtration phase, in flame-resistant clothes, or in conveyor belts. Polyphenylene Sulfide Market Segment Analysis – By End-Use Industry

The automotive segment held the largest share of 40% in the polyphenylene sulfide market in 2021, followed by electrical and electronics. Polyphenylene sulfide is used in the automotive industry for the manufacturing of under-the-hood automotive components like engines and auto parts that are operating under high temperature and pressure environments, as it is resistant to fuel, transmission, and brake fluids at high temperatures. Automotive components such as fuel system parts, induction systems, coolant systems, lighting components, and electrical & electronic components are made from Polyphenylene sulfide. Polyphenylene sulfide is also used in the aerospace and defense industry and is increasingly used as composites in airplane manufacturing like the Airbus A380 and Boeing 787 Dreamliner, which uses up to 50% of these composites in the primary structure including fuselage and wings. Increasing consumption of polyphenylene sulfide in high-temperature applications due to its mechanical characteristics and superior performance is expected to drive market growth over the forecast period. Polyphenylene sulfide helps to increase the fuel economy in both vehicles and aircraft, is 100% recyclable, and significantly reduces emission levels. Polyphenylene Sulfide Market Challenges

Existence of substitute and volatility of prices

Polyphenylene sulfide has its own special features and properties compared to the ordinarily used materials, which makes them unique and much more efficient for various applications. With that being the case, it becomes quite hard for the manufacturers and consumers with the constant fluctuation of polyphenylene sulfide prices that ranges from $9 – $18 per kg. And because of these inconvenient price fluctuations, the manufacturers end up incurring loss sometimes, which acts as a major restraint to the growth of the market. High production costs may also be a major threat to the growth of the polyphenylene sulfide (PPS) market. The existence of substitute compounds such as PEEK and PEI, as well as varying raw material costs, acts as a key restraint for the polyphenylene sulfide market growth.
